Solution

The correct option is C 399 min
Half life of reaction = 120 min
We know that,
For first order reaction,
k=0.693t1/2

k=0.693120=5.77×103 min1

First order reaction equation,
t=2.303klog aax

For 90% decomposition,
If a=100,x=90
(ax)=10

So,
t=2.3035.77×103log 10010090

t=2.3035.77×103log 10=2.3035.77×103=399 min

Thus, option (c) is correct.
